Geen vermelding als veld leeg is

Status
Niet open voor verdere reacties.

Friend

Verenigingslid
Lid geworden
31 jan 2009
Berichten
1.137
Beste forummers,

Op een formulier in een veld tekstvak heb ik de volgende code staan om verschillende velden netjes achter elkaar te zetten

Code:
=[titkort] & " " & [voorl] & IIf([voorn]="";"";" (" & [voorn] & ") " & [tv] & " " & [achternm])

Als er een voornaam bekend is van iemand wil ik deze tussen haakjes zetten en als er geen voornaam bekend is geen haakjes laten zien en ook geen spaties.

Uiteindelijk ook met het veld tv.

Nu lukt het mij niet om dit met deze code voor elkaar te krijgen.

Het werkt wel als ik bijvoorbeeld een vaste voornaam ingeef:

Code:
=[titkort] & " " & [voorl] & IIf([voorn]="Jan";"";" (" & [voorn] & ") " & [tv] & " " & [achternm])

Wat doe ik fout.

Friend
 
Laatst bewerkt:
Ik gebruik de constructie altijd zo:
Code:
Naam: [Voornaam] & " " & [Tussenvoegsels]+" " & [Achternaam]
 
Michel,

Hartelijk dank voor je reactie :thumb:

Die + methode kende ik niet. Geweldig die gaan we erin houden :D

Tegelijkertijd ook de haakjes daarmee opgelost:

Code:
=[titkort]+ " "& [voorl]+" " & "("+[voorn]+") " & [tv]+" " & [achternm]

Hartelijk dank voor je oplossing :thumb:

Zuiver voor de nieuw(leer)sgierigheid:

Op mijn manier kan het nooit werken ??

Friend
 
Alles kan :). Krijg je zoiets:
Code:
VolNaam: [titkort] + " " & [Voorl] & " " & IIf([voorn] Is Null;"";"(" & [voorn] & ")") & " " & [tv]+" " & [achternm]
 
Michel,

Had niet anders van jou verwacht : ;) :D

Kan ik toch even zien wat ik fout heb gedaan.

Maar ik hou de + methode erin :thumb::thumb:

Thanks

Friend
 
Als je maar snapt waarom -ie werkt :d.
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an